West Ham and Valencia have both today had £29m bids accepted for Celta Vigo striker Maxi Gomez, according to Sky Sports.

The Hammers made the Uruguayan their top target at the beginning of the transfer window and is a player Manuel Pellegrini admires greatly.

He scored 13 goals last season in a struggling Celta Vigo side and would be a welcome addition to West Ham should he choose to join them over Valencia.

It is now up to the player himself whether he wants to play Champions League football at Valencia next season or if he prefers a choice of living in London and playing at London Stadium.
